Título:
Finite-dimensional pointed Hopf algebras over finite 3 simple groups of Lie type V. Mixed classes in Chevalley and Steinberg groups

Resumen:
We show that all classes that are neither semisimple nor unipotent in finite simple Chevalley or Steinberg groups different from PSLn(q) collapse (i.e. are never the support of a finite-dimensional Nichols algebra). As a consequence, we prove that the only finite-dimensional pointed Hopf algebra whose group of group-like elements is PSp2n(q) , PΩ4n+(q), PΩ4n-(q), 3D4(q) , E7(q) , E8(q) , F4(q) , or G2(q) with q even is the group algebra.
